So I'm not sure what Google is referring to here. As you can see in the ISPD paper ( https://vlsicad.ucsd.edu/Publications/Conferences/396/c396.p... ) on page 5, they openly compare Cadence CMP with AutoDMP and other algorithims quantitatively. The only obfuscation is with the proprietary GF12 technology, where they can't provide absolute numbers, but only relative ones. Comparison against commercial tools is actuall…

The UCSD paper says "We thank ... colleagues at Cadence and Synopsys for policy changes that permit our methods and results to be reproducible and sharable in the open, toward advancement of research in the field." This suggests that there may have been policies restricting publication prior to this work. It would be intriguing to see if future research on AlphaChip could receive a similar endorsement or support from…

Cadence in particular has been quite receptive to allowing academics and researchers to benchmark new algorithms against their tools. They have also been quite permissive with letting people publish TCL scripts for their tools (https://github.com/TILOS-AI-Institute/MacroPlacement/tree/ma...) that in theory should enable precise reproduction of results. From my knowledge, Cadence has been very permissive from 2022 onwards, so while Google's objections to publishing data from CMP may have been valid when the Nature paper was published, they are no longer valid today.

You are correct. For commercial use, the GPUs used for training and fine-tuning aren't a problem financially. However, if we wanted to rigorously benchmark AlphaChip against simulated annealing or other floorplanning algorithms, we have to afford the same compute and runtime budget to each algorithm. With 16 GPUs running for 6 hours, you could explore a huge placement space using any algorithm, and it isn't clear if…

You're saying that if the other methods were given the equivalent amount of compute they might be able to perform as well as AlphaChip? Or at least that the comparison would be fairer? Are the other methods scalable in that way?

Existing mixed-placement algorithms depend on hyperparameters, heuristics, and initial states / randomness. If afforded more compute resources, they can explore a much wider space and in theory come up with better solutions. Some algorithms like simulated annealing are easy to modify to exploit arbitrarily more compute resources. Indeed, I believe the comparison of AlphaChip to alternatives would be fairer if compute resources and allowed runtime were matched.

In fact, existing algorithms such as naive simulated annealing can be easily augmented with ML (e.g. using state embeddings to optimize hyperparameters for a given problem instance, or using a regression model to fine-tune proxy costs to better correlate with final QoR). Indeed, I strongly suspect commercial CAD software is already applying ML in many ways for mixed-placement and other CAD algorithms. The criticism against AlphaChip isn't about rejecting any application of ML to EDA CAD algorithms, but rather the particular formulation they used and objections to their reported results / comparisons.

It seems that Chatterjee - the bad guy in your linked article - is now suing Google because he thinks he got canned for pointing out that his boss - Jeff Dean mentioned in the article discussed here - was knowingly publishing fraudulent claims.

"To be clear, we do NOT have evidence to believe that RL outperforms academic state-of—art and strongest commercial macro placers. The comparisons for the latter were done so poorly that in many cases the commercial tool failed to run due to installation issues." and that's supposedly a screenshot from an internal presentation done by Jeff Dean.

https://regmedia.co.uk/2023/03/26/satrajit_vs_google.pdf

As an outsider, I find it very difficult to judge if Chatterjee was a bad and expensive hire (because he suppressed good results by coworkers) or if he was a very valuable employee (because he tried to prevent publishing false statements).
